Full Transcript of The Video

Eric Siu: Okay, so in this video I'm going to talk about how to 10X your Content Output with this framework. So I talk about this framework all the time. And I think nowadays everyone's producing so much content out there, it's important to think about how you can maximize your content. This framework is from Aleyda Solis, and this is the Content Reusage Framework. You can call it the content repurposing framework, you can call it whatever you want. When you think about your content, if you write a blog post, do you just write the blog post and then just publish it, and then it just kind of sails off into the sunset? If you're doing that it's probably a big mistake, right? You're spending $400-$500 on a post, $1,000 on a post, and then it just kind of goes out there to die. You don't buy a car and then drive it for a week, and then you're done. You drive it for as long as you can until you need to get a new car.
As a matter of fact, I was watching a video yesterday, Jeff Bezos, when he was worth eight or nine billion dollars, he was still driving a Honda Accord. He was getting interviewed by 60 Minutes. How can you maximize the mileage on what you're producing or what you're using? The first step is when you have a piece of content, this works really well for us, we are updating it. So we have this one post on SEO techniques, we have this other post on marketing companies or case studies. Before we update it we're getting like 500 visits to that post per month, after we update it, we're getting about 4,000 visits a month. So think about how you can constantly update the posts that are doing well for you.
Step number two, is expanding your piece of content. So you update it to make sure it's up to date, but also expanding it. When Wikipedia first started Abraham Lincoln's page was only 3,000 words or so. Now it's about 15,000 words. They keep updating it all the time because Wikipedia has users constantly updating all the time. They are kind of the defacto pieces of content and more and more people will link to it because it's so good. It's just so big. That is the best piece of content. The third thing is you've got to reformat your piece of content too. If I'm doing a blog post, already it's done really well, why don't I make it into a webinar? Why don't I make into a video like this? Why don't I make it into a podcast? Why don't I make into social media images? So you've got to reformat too.
Curating is step number four. When your curate a piece of content, how can you take it and make it into multiple social media images, and then pushing it out there to your social media channels? Right now in our Instagram, we have a team that's just focused on taking a lot of our quotes out there, interviews we have, videos we have, and just posting it to our Instagram, our Twitter, and our Facebook. That's starting to do well for us. People are starting to engage with it more and more. The final thing you need to do here is refocus your piece of content. Let's say you're talking about SEO techniques for 2017. Maybe you might say, "Okay, why don't I talk about black hat SEI techniques for 2017 or 2018 or whatever in the future." You have all these pieces of content already. Why don't you spend maybe one time per month thinking about how you can refocus a piece of content? How you can do all these different things. Do these things first before you think about constantly producing new content.
You've got to have this framework set, and then talk about it with your content team. And then once you start doing this, you get in a flow. You're going to be able to crank out a lot more content.
